automatic computerized geschwindigkeitsumschaltung machine.

机译:自动电脑速度切换机。

摘要

The thrust exerted on a drill bit (14) is sensed and employed to determine the speed at which the bit is driven. A controller (26) for the drill (10) compares the thrust to a predetermined threshold value and in response to the comparison emits a control signal which shifts a transmission (22) in the drill into high or low speed. After each shift, a number of thrust samples are taken in order to compute an average thrust for different strata (A, B, C) of the material (W) being drilled. At the completion of drilling each hole, the average thrusts for the hole are used to recalibrate the shift threshold value. In this manner, the shift threshold is adjusted to compensate for drill bit wear. The sensed thrust is also compared to a bit reject threshold value to determine when the bit is too dull for proper drilling.
